Fig. 3. Somites in b567 mutant embryos are enlarged in the AP dimension. Whereas live 24 hpf wild-type embryos have reiterated somites over regular intervals (A, arrows), b567 mutant embryos (B) have enlarged somites (arrows) with weak boundaries in between (arrowhead). (C-E) F59 staining highlights the large, irregular boundaries in both b567 mutant and her1+7 MO-injected embryos. Again, arrows denote strong boundaries and arrowheads denote weak boundaries. Molecular evidence of large somites is seen by expression of a titin homolog (F,G).
